

















In the competitive landscape of digital marketing, simply producing high-quality content is no longer sufficient. The way you structure and layout your content profoundly influences how search engines crawl, index, and rank your pages, as well as how users engage with your site. This comprehensive guide unpacks the intricate techniques and actionable steps needed to optimize your content layout for maximum SEO impact, moving beyond surface-level advice into technical mastery.
Table of Contents
- Understanding the Role of Content Layout in SEO Optimization
- Analyzing and Mapping Your Content Hierarchy for SEO
- Implementing Advanced HTML and Semantic Markup Techniques
- Designing a Content Layout That Prioritizes SEO Goals
- Enhancing User Experience to Support SEO Objectives
- Technical SEO Checks and Validation for Content Layout
- Practical Application: Creating a Sample Content Layout for a Blog Post
- Summary: Reinforcing the Value of Strategic Content Layout in SEO
1. Understanding the Role of Content Layout in SEO Optimization
a) How Content Structure Influences Search Engine Crawling and Indexing
Effective content layout serves as a roadmap for search engine crawlers, guiding them through your content in a logical hierarchy. A well-structured layout with clear semantic elements ensures that crawlers can accurately interpret the importance and relationship of each section. For instance, using <section> tags to demarcate thematic areas, combined with <header> tags for headings, helps search engines understand content flow.
Concrete Action: Implement a <section> for each primary topic, and within it, use <h1> to <h6> tags to denote hierarchy. Use <article> for standalone content blocks like blog posts or testimonials. This semantic clarity improves crawl efficiency and keyword relevance.
b) The Impact of Visual Hierarchy and Readability on User Engagement
A meticulously designed visual hierarchy directs user attention to critical keywords, calls-to-action (CTAs), and conversion points. It also enhances readability, reducing bounce rates and increasing time on page—factors positively correlated with SEO rankings.
Practical Tip: Use size, color, and whitespace strategically. For example, headlines should be prominent, while secondary information is subdued. Incorporate font-weight and font-size variations in CSS to differentiate levels of importance without overwhelming the reader.
c) Case Study: SEO Improvements Through Strategic Content Reorganization
A client in the e-commerce sector restructured their product pages by implementing semantic HTML and optimizing the visual hierarchy. By reorganizing content into <section> tags, emphasizing primary keywords in headers, and decluttering navigation, they achieved a 35% increase in organic traffic within three months. This demonstrates how structured layout and semantic markup directly influence SEO performance.
2. Analyzing and Mapping Your Content Hierarchy for SEO
a) Conducting a Content Audit to Identify Hierarchical Gaps
Begin with a comprehensive content audit: catalog all existing pages, posts, and sections. Use tools like Screaming Frog or Ahrefs Site Audit to analyze current structure. Identify orphaned pages, duplicate content, or areas lacking clear hierarchy.
Actionable Step: Create a spreadsheet mapping URLs to their current hierarchy, noting where content overlaps or is underrepresented. Prioritize restructuring or consolidating content that lacks clear parent-child relationships.
b) Creating a Clear Content Hierarchy Diagram
Visualize your content hierarchy with diagrams or mind maps. Use tools like Lucidchart or draw.io to craft a tree structure that delineates Tier 1 (broad topics), Tier 2 (subtopics), and Tier 3 (detailed content). Ensure that primary pages link naturally to supporting content.
Practical Implementation: For a blog about digital marketing, Tier 1 could be “SEO,” Tier 2 “On-Page SEO,” “Off-Page SEO,” and Tier 3 specific articles on backlinks, keyword research, etc.
c) Internal Linking Strategies to Reinforce Hierarchical Structure
Establish a robust internal linking plan that reflects your hierarchy. Link from Tier 1 pages to Tier 2, and from Tier 2 to Tier 3 content, ensuring anchor text is descriptive and keyword-rich. Use contextual links within content to guide crawlers and users seamlessly.
Pro Tip: Implement breadcrumb navigation that mirrors your hierarchy, enhancing both user experience and search engine understanding.
3. Implementing Advanced HTML and Semantic Markup Techniques
a) Using HTML5 Semantic Elements (e.g., <header>, <article>, <section>, <aside>) for Clarity
Semantic elements provide meaningful context to search engines and assistive technologies. Replace generic <div> tags with appropriate tags:
- <header>: Wrap site headers and page titles.
- <section>: Segment thematic content areas.
- <article>: Encapsulate standalone content like blog posts.
- <aside>: Insert secondary information, related links, or ads.
Example: Replacing a generic <div> with <section> for your “About Us” section clarifies its purpose, aiding SEO clarity.
b) Applying Schema Markup to Highlight Content Types and Relationships
Implement schema.org structured data to annotate your content, enhancing SERP features. Use JSON-LD scripts to add context, such as article, product, or breadcrumb schemas.
| Schema Type | Purpose | Implementation Tip |
|---|---|---|
| Article | Enhances visibility of blog posts in rich snippets | Include author, datePublished, headline |
| BreadcrumbList | Shows page hierarchy in SERPs | Align with your internal linking structure |
c) Practical Example: Structuring a Blog Post with Semantic Tags for SEO
Consider the following semantic HTML snippet for a blog post:
<article itemscope itemtype="http://schema.org/BlogPosting">
<header>
<h1 itemprop="headline">Optimizing Content Layout for SEO</h1>
<p>Published on <time itemprop="datePublished" datetime="2024-04-25">April 25, 2024</time></p>
</header>
<section itemprop="articleBody">
<p>Effective content layout enhances crawlability and user engagement...</p>
</section>
<footer>
<p>Author: Jane Doe</p>
</footer>
</article>
This structure clearly delineates content, employs schema markup, and improves SEO signals.
4. Designing a Content Layout That Prioritizes SEO Goals
a) Establishing Visual Flow to Highlight Key Keywords and Calls-to-Action
Create a visual hierarchy that naturally guides users toward your primary keywords and CTAs. Use CSS techniques such as Flexbox or Grid to position these elements prominently at the top or center of your layout.
Implementation Tip: Use CSS properties like order, z-index, and margin to control element stacking and flow. For example, place your main CTA immediately below the headline with increased font size and contrasting color.
b) Optimizing Placement of Important Content for Mobile and Desktop
Responsive design is critical. Use media queries to adapt layout components, ensuring that key content remains accessible and prominent across devices. For mobile, prioritize vertical stacking; for desktop, utilize multi-column layouts.
Actionable Step: Implement CSS Grid for desktop views:
@media (min-width: 768px) {
.main-grid {
display: grid;
grid-template-columns: 2fr 1fr;
grid-gap: 20px;
}
}
c) Step-by-Step Guide: Using CSS Grid and Flexbox to Create Responsive, SEO-Friendly Layouts
- Define your layout containers: Use semantic tags like
<section>with descriptive class names. - Set up CSS Grid: Apply display: grid; to container, define grid-template-columns, and assign grid areas for key sections.
- Implement Flexbox inside grid areas: For content blocks requiring flexible alignment, use display: flex; with appropriate justify-content and align-items.
- Ensure responsiveness: Use media queries to switch between grid and flex layouts or adjust grid parameters for different screen sizes.
- Test extensively: Use Chrome DevTools device emulation to verify layout behavior across devices.
Practical tip: Always include width, max-width, and min-width properties to prevent layout breaking on edge cases.
5. Enhancing User Experience to Support SEO Objectives
a) Improving Page Load Speed Through Layout and Asset Optimization
Optimize CSS delivery by minimizing and inlining critical CSS. Use tools like PurgeCSS to remove unused styles. Compress images with modern formats (WebP, AVIF) and implement responsive images with <picture> tags.
Implement lazy loading for images and videos:
<img src="image.webp" loading="lazy" alt="Descriptive Alt Text">
b) Ensuring Accessibility and Readability for All Users
Use semantic HTML elements, sufficient color contrast (minimum WCAG AA standards), and keyboard navigability. Incorporate ARIA labels where necessary, and ensure text resizing does not break layout.
c) Implementing Lazy Loading and Asynchronous Content Loading Techniques
Besides images, load non-critical scripts asynchronously using async or defer attributes. Lazy load below-the-fold content with Intersection Observer API:
